LMPS TO SHARE SKILLS TOWARDS ENDING CRIME

Maseru, Aug. 09 — Crime is an economic threat that needs collaboration from all the relevant departments towards achieving a crime free community.

This was said by the Lesotho Mounted Police Service (LMPS) Head of Interpol and Officer Commanding Interpol National Central Bureau Maseru when highlighting on an agreement that LMPS signed with the Financial Intelligence Unit (FIU)

Speaking in an interview with the Agency on Wednesday, Superintendent Tholang Leteba said the agreement is aimed at expanding the Interpol policing capabilities with other law enforcement agencies across the country.
